The Junge Waldorf Philharmonie (JWP) is a project orchestra that has been in existence since 2004 and brings together young, talented musicians from Germany and abroad. It is supported by a purely voluntary organizational team made up entirely of young people. They plan and organize the rehearsal phase and concerts over the course of a year - without any state support. The orchestra itself only comes together for two intensive weeks to develop a challenging concert program under professional guidance and present it at the highest level.
Founded in 2004 by Sebastian Brüning, a former pupil of the Gutenhalde Waldorf School, the JWP offers a concentrated yet collaborative rehearsal atmosphere. The work is carried out under the direction of experienced teachers and conductor Patrick Strub, who has been shaping the musical level of the orchestra for many years.
The final concert in Stuttgart in the Beethoven Hall of the Liederhalle is the highlight of this year's work phase. The program includes:
- Overture to the opera "Nabucco" in F major by Giuseppe Verdi
- Double Concerto for Clarinet and Viola in E minor op. 88 by Max Bruch
- 10th Symphony in E minor op. 93 by Dmitri Shostakovich
The soloists are Midori Kusakabe (viola) and Niklas Malcharczyk (clarinet). The program combines Italian operatic tradition, romantic chamber music in orchestral form and a central symphonic work of the 20th century.
